From: André Apitzsch <g...@apitzsch.eu> This dts adds support for BQ Aquaris X5 Plus (Longcheer L9360) released in 2016.
Add a device tree with initial support for: - GPIO keys - NFC - SDHCI - Status LED - Touchscreen Signed-off-by: André Apitzsch <g...@apitzsch.eu> --- arch/arm64/boot/dts/qcom/Makefile | 1 + .../boot/dts/qcom/msm8976-longcheer-l9360.dts | 532 +++++++++++++++++++++ 2 files changed, 533 insertions(+) diff --git a/arch/arm64/boot/dts/qcom/Makefile b/arch/arm64/boot/dts/qcom/Makefile index 669b888b27a1daa93ac15f47e8b9a302bb0922c2..80fd9a910af478558bb840f7ce5aa52948912be0 100644 --- a/arch/arm64/boot/dts/qcom/Makefile +++ b/arch/arm64/boot/dts/qcom/Makefile @@ -77,6 +77,7 @@ dtb-$(CONFIG_ARCH_QCOM) += msm8953-xiaomi-tissot.dtb dtb-$(CONFIG_ARCH_QCOM) += msm8953-xiaomi-vince.dtb dtb-$(CONFIG_ARCH_QCOM) += msm8956-sony-xperia-loire-kugo.dtb dtb-$(CONFIG_ARCH_QCOM) += msm8956-sony-xperia-loire-suzu.dtb +dtb-$(CONFIG_ARCH_QCOM) += msm8976-longcheer-l9360.dtb dtb-$(CONFIG_ARCH_QCOM) += msm8992-lg-bullhead-rev-10.dtb dtb-$(CONFIG_ARCH_QCOM) += msm8992-lg-bullhead-rev-101.dtb dtb-$(CONFIG_ARCH_QCOM) += msm8992-lg-h815.dtb diff --git a/arch/arm64/boot/dts/qcom/msm8976-longcheer-l9360.dts b/arch/arm64/boot/dts/qcom/msm8976-longcheer-l9360.dts new file mode 100644 index 0000000000000000000000000000000000000000..b7040973f85972fabde3b6b50cb2eb323b645537 --- /dev/null +++ b/arch/arm64/boot/dts/qcom/msm8976-longcheer-l9360.dts @@ -0,0 +1,532 @@ +// SPDX-License-Identifier: BSD-3-Clause +/* + * Copyright (c) 2025, André Apitzsch <g...@apitzsch.eu> + */ + +/dts-v1/;
